Я новичок во флаттере.
Я создал приложение, которое анализирует формат .JSON из тела .php, используя http.get()
/http.post()
,
все работает нормально при использовании локальной базы данных и локального сервера Apache на моем ноутбуке.
проблема возникла, когда я применил этот проект, используя сервер Windows (домен) в качестве сервера базы данных и сервера Apache, мои приложения флаттера больше не работают.
Когда я пытался получить доступ к файлу .php (checkConnection.php), используя мой браузер на моем ноутбуке / телефоне с Android, он отображал всплывающее окно с запросом аутентификации Windows.
checkConnection.php работал, когда я вводил свою учетную запись домена.
ВОПРОС.
Кто-нибудь знает альтернативный способ решения этой проблемы?
может быть что-то вроде сохранения моих учетных данных в коде?
Это код, который я использовал в своем приложении:
final response =
await http.post("http://172.28.16.84/mobileglpi/login.php", body: {
'username': txt_username.text,
'password': txt_password.text,
});
var datauser = json.decode(response.body);
Задача ещё не решена.
Других решений пока нет …